AgnosiousD, I hate to be the one to break it to you, but that's not how Prophecies of that type work.

Prophecies modeled after Monstrous Treasure choose a list of possible areas upon activation of the Prophecy and keeps that list of areas as long as it is active. This means that if you activate MT, then enter a Shrine Map, and it doesn't trigger, you are guaranteed to never trigger MT on a Shrine Map until you seal it and re-activate it, or you trigger MT on a different Map. This means, if you had 9,999 Shrine Maps, and you activated MT, it is very possible to run all 9,999 Shrine Maps in a row with no MT activation.

Ok then, what should i do to maximize stability of proph's procs? The only way is doing reseal after each 'fail' activation? Or i must change maps, prophecy...etc


It depends on the specific prophecy, but basically, yes.

The cheapest way to make sure you get a Monstrous Treasure is to run as many different Map bases as possible. (Dunes failed? Go to Grotto. Grotto failed? Go to Mesa. Mesa failed? Go to Tower. etc.)
